    Abstract: A toner hopper contains toner supplied from a toner container and supplies the toner to a developing device. The toner hopper includes: a container tank for containing the toner; a carrying screw which is disposed in the container tank and is rotated so as to carry the toner in the container tank; and an elastic member having a first section which is fixed to the container tank and a second section which comes into contact with the carrying screw, the first section being farther from the carrying screw than the second section in a direction perpendicular to an axis line of the carrying screw. According to the arrangement, it is possible to stabilize an amount of toner supplied from the toner hopper to the developing device.

    Abstract: A toner cartridge is a developer storage container for storing toner (developer) in a hollow cylindrical section that is driven to rotate on its axis so that the stored toner is discharged from an outlet. The cylindrical section has an inner circumferential surface provided with a plurality of liner protruding portions that extend in a direction tilted with respect to a rotation direction of the cylindrical section. Moreover, the toner cartridge includes a stirring member capable of moving in the cylindrical section so as to collide with the protruding portions. This makes it possible to stably supply a developer and to realize an inexpensive developer storage container whose size can be reduced.

    Abstract: An agitator includes a film formed with one or more slits. The film may be partitioned into two or more areas by the slits, substantially equally in an axial direction of a rotating shaft of the film. In both ends of a film holding member, supporting plates may be disposed at positions facing outer ends of both end areas of the film with respect to the axial direction. With this structure, during rotation of the agitator, greater stress may be produced in the outer end of each end area than in an inner end of each end area and a center area in its entirety. Thus, a component applied in a direction along the rotating shaft may be applied to a direction in which developer is fed, so that an adequate amount of developer may be supplied.

    Abstract: An image forming apparatus equipped with an improved developer detecting device and agitating device to simplify an inner structure of a developing device and/or a waste developer container while reducing the number of components and costs. The image forming apparatus includes a developer storage part to store a developer, a light emitting part and a light receiving part provided to detect an amount of developer stored in the developer storage part, and a rotating unit which rotates to agitate the developer stored in the developer storage part and guides light emitted from the light emitting part to the light receiving part. The rotating unit includes two rotating members. Each of the rotating members has a rotating shaft portion and an extending portion which extends eccentrically from the rotating shaft portion. The extending portions oppose each other to define a developer detecting region therebetween. When the rotating unit rotates, the developer detecting region moves upward and downward.
